Last month, the Building Our Future Care & Communication Subcommittee hosted another Connection Session. This time the topic of conversation was “Church Without Walls.” Thank you to everyone who attended.

We learned a lot about our community though small group conversations learning about what types of experiences we enjoy outside of Unity that can be described as spiritual, meaningful and soulful versus fun, creative and dynamic. Today, we would like to share with all of you several of the key takeaways.

There were 5 common themes related to experiences that are considered Spiritual, Meaningful & Soulful.

  • Retreats

  • Travel Opportunities

  • Activities in Groups or in Solitude

  • Self-development Programs

  • Outdoor Activities & Elements

There were several examples mentioned by numerous people that could be included in multiple categories. These Include the following: yoga, meditation, music, service opportunities, 12-step programs, Prosperity Classes, Alcoholic Anonymous, Landmark or Gratitude trainings, gardening, hiking, nature trails, and more.

There were 7 descriptive themes related to experiences that are considered Dynamic, Fun & Creative.

  • Explorative

  • Artistic

  • Passion-related

  • Immersive

  • Interactive

  • Multi-beneficial

  • Unique

Many of the experiences mentioned followed along with these themes especially when related to service opportunities, fundraisers, community outings, and self-development programs. The experiences that were special and stood out from everyday events were those that incorporated multiple themes. Some specific events mentions included the following: Broadway shows, concerts by icons, storytelling events (The Moth, Lip Service, Pechacucha), Arsht Center performances, Van Gogh experience, dark dining, Painting with a Twist, Drag Bingo, Full Moon Kayaking, drumming circles, New World Symphony Wallcasts, night gardens, treasure mapping, Yogadance, skydiving, and more.
